Magnetic and transport measurements on heavy fermion compounds CeAl 3, CeCu2Si2 and CeRu2Si2 are reported. Transport properties show that in CeRu2Si2, the f electron is more delocalized than in CeAl3 or CeCu 2Si2. Magnetic data show the apparent cancellation of magnetic correlations for the CeAl3 and CeRu2Si 2 compounds which have a nonmagnetic normal ground state; by contrast antiferromagnetic correlations lead to the decrease of the low temperature susceptibility of CeCu2Si2 which has a superconducting ground state.
